About The Foundation For Contemporary Arts
Since its inception in 1963, the mission of the Foundation for Contemporary Arts (FCA) is to encourage, sponsor, and promote innovative work in the arts. FCA was founded by and depends on artists and a community of like-minded supporters—including philanthropic individuals, foundations, and government agencies—to fund its programs. To date, over 1,000 artists have contributed artworks to help fund grant programs that directly support individual artists. FCA annually awards unrestricted, by-nomination grants to 23 artists working in dance, music/sound, performance art/theater, poetry, and the visual arts in recognition of their artistic contributions; and maintains a by-application emergency grants fund, decided and disbursed monthly, to help over 200 artists per year with unexpected presentation opportunities and project-related emergencies. In 2025, FCA’s inaugural Creative Research Grants provided 30 artists with $10,000 awards to support critical exploratory phases of their artistic process. Since FCA’s inception, more than 7,500 grants awarded to artists and arts organizations—soon to surpass $30 million—have provided opportunities for creative exploration and realization of new work. An organization founded by artists, for artists, FCA has grown carefully over decades—and is focused today on strategic and sustainable growth of artist support through our core programs, and our capacity to meet the evolving needs of the experimental field. Job Description FCA is seeking a full-time, permanent Finance and Operations Manager who will report to the Executive Director and play a pivotal role in our team of eight. The position works closely with the Deputy Director and provides guidance as needed to the Artwork and Operations Associate and external bookkeeper. The Finance and Operations manager is responsible for ensuring that FCA’s day-to-day business and financial operations run effectively and efficiently, both in-office and remotely; encompassing office management, accounting and finance management, employee benefits administration, IT and administrative systems. The position works in close coordination with the Artwork and Operations Associate to ensure supportive infrastructure for FCA’s artwork contributions and sales activities to further the organization’s mission.
